Starting System
Starter Test lcont'dl
Ch€ck tor Wear and Damage
The starter should crank the engine smoothly and
steadily, lf the starter engages. but cranks the engine
erratically, remove it, and inspect the starter drive gear
and torque converter or flywheel ring gear for damage.
. Check the drive gear overrunning clutch for binding
or slipping when the armature is rotated with the
drive gear held,- lf damaged. replace the gears.
Check Cranking Voltsge and Curr€nt Draw
Cranking voltage should be no less than 8.5 volts.
Current draw should be no more than 350 amperes.
lf cranking voltage is too low, or current draw too high,
check for;
. dead or low batterv.
. open circuit in starter armature commutator seg-
ments,
. starter armature dragging.
. shorted armature winding.
o excessive drag in engine.
Check Cranking rpm
Engine speed during cranking should be above 100 rpm,
lf speed is too low, check for:
. loose battery or stanerterminals.
. excessively worn starter brushes,
. open circuit in commutator segments.
o dirty or damaged helical spline or drive gear.
. defective drive gear overrunning clutch.
Check Siarter Disengag€ment
With the shift lever in El or @ position (A/T) or with the
clutch pedal depressed (M/T), turn the ignition switch to
START (lll), and release to ON (ll).
The starter drive gear should disengage from the torque
converter or flywheel ring gear when you release the
Key.
lf the drive gear hangs up on the torque converter or fly-
wheel ring gear, check for:
. solenoid plunger and switch malfunction,
. dirty drive gear assembly or damaged overrunning
clutch.

It -Alternator Belt Inspection and Adiustment
Deflection Method:
Apply a force of 98 N (10 kgl,22lbll, and measure the
deflection between the alternator and the crankshaft pul-
ley.
Detlection | 8.0 - 10.5 mm (0.31 - 0.41 in)
NOTE: On a brand-new belt {one that has been run for less
than five minutes). the deflection should be 6.0 - 8.5 mm
(0.26 - 0.33 in) when first measured. If the belt is worn or
damaged, replace it.
CRANKSHAFTPULLEY
lf adiustm€nt is necossary:
1. Loosen the lower mounting nut and the upper mount-
ing bolt.
2, Move the alternator to obtain the proper belt tension,
then retighten the upper mounting bolt and the lower
mounting nut to the specified torques.
3. Recheckthe deflection ofthe belt.

Belt T€nsion Gauge Method:
Following the gauge manufacturer's instructions. attach
the soecial tool to the belt, and measure the tension.
Tension 340 - 490 N (35 - 50 kgf,77 - 110lbf)
NOTE: On a brand-new belt {one that has been run for less
than five minutes), the tension should be 540 -740 N
(55 - 75 kgf, 121 - 165 lbf) when first measured. lf the belt
is worn or damaged, replace it.
PULLEY BELT TENSION GAUGE
07JGG - 0010104
It adiustment is necossary:
1, Loosen the lower mounting nut and the upper mount-
ing bolt.
2. Move the alternator to obtain the proper belt tension.
then retighten the upper mounting bolt and the lower
mounting nut to the specified torques
3. Recheck the tension of the belt

In the "OHMS" range, the DVOM will measure
resistance between two points along a circuit.
Low resistance means good continuity.
Diodes and solid-state devices in a circuit can
make a DVOM give a false reading. To check
a reading, reverse the leads, and take a
second reading. lf the readings differ, the
component is affecting lhe measurement.
Jumper Wire
Use a jumper wire to bypass an open circuit.
A iumper wire is made up ot an in-line fuse
holder connected to a set of test leads. lt
should have a five amoere fuse. Never
connect a jumper wire across a short circuit.
The direct battery short will blow the fuse.
Short Finder (Short Circuit Locater)
Short finders are available to locale shorts to
ground. The short tinder creates a pulsing
magnetic field in the shorted circuit whlch you
can follow to the location of the short. lts use
is explained on page 15.

Troubleshooting Precautions
Before Troubleshooting
1. Check the main fuse and the fuse box.
2. Check the battery for damage, state of
charge, and clean and tight connections.
CAUTION:
. Do not quick-charge a battery unlers
the battery ground cable has been
disconnected, or you will damage the
alternator diodes.
. Do not attempt to crank the engine wlth
the ground cable disconnected or you
will severely damage the wiring.
While You're Working
1. Make sure connectors are clean, and have
no loose terminals or receptacles.
2. Make sure lhat connectors without wire
seals are packed with dielectric (silicone)
grease. Part Number: 08798-9001 .
Pack wllh dlelectrlc (sillcons) greass
When connecting a connector, push it until it"clicks" into place.
Do not pull on the wires when
disconnecting a connector. Pull
only on the connector houslngs.
Most circuits Include solid-state
devlces. Test the voltages In these
circuits only with a lo-megaohm or
higher impedance digital multlm6ter.
Never use a test light or analog meter
on chcuits that contain solld-state
devices. Damage to the devices
may result.

Brake System Indicator Light (cont'd)
- How the Circuit Works
The brake system indicator light comes on to alert
the driver that the parking brake is applied, or that
the brake fluid level is low. lt also comes on as a
bulb test when the engine is cranked.
Parking Brake
With the ignition switch in ON (ll) or START (lll),
voltage is applied through fuse 25 to the brake
system light. When you apply the parking brake, the
switch closes and provides a ground for the light.
The light then comes on to remind you that the
parking brake is applied.
Brake Fluid Level
With the ignition switch in ON (ll) or START (lll),
voltage is applied through fuse 25 to the brake
system light. lf the brake fluid level is low, the brake
fluid level switch closes, providing ground to the
circuit. The brake system light then comes on,
alerting the d verto a low brake fluid level in the
brake master cylinder. (Check brake pad wear
before you add fluid).
Bulb Check
With the ignition switch in START (lll) and clutch
pedal depressed or A'lT gear selector in PARK (P)
or NEUTRAL (N), voltage is applied through fuse 31
to the brake bulb check circuit. The brake bulb
check circuit closes, allowing current to flow through
the brake system light and bulb check circuit to
ground. The brake system light then comes on to
test the bulb.
